## 引言 近些年来,区块链技术的迅速发展为游戏行业带来了新的机遇与挑战。区块链游戏不仅提供了去中心化的交易方式,还为玩家创造了前所未有的经济激励。然而,伴随着这些创新的出现,安全性问题也日益凸显。本文将深入探讨区块链游戏的安全性,包括可能存在的风险、影响这些风险的因素、应对措施和最佳实践。 ## 区块链游戏的基本概念 区块链游戏是基于区块链技术构建的游戏,它允许玩家拥有、交易和管理数字资产(如NFT)。这种方式使得玩家的资产透明且不可篡改,从而增强了玩家对游戏的信任。 区块链游戏的最大特点是其去中心化的特性,这使得游戏在运行时不再依赖单一的服务器,而是在多个节点上分散存储和管理。区块链游戏的兴起不仅改变了传统游戏的经济模式,也引发了新一轮的技术革命。 ## 区块链游戏的安全性概述 随着越来越多的玩家进入区块链游戏领域,安全性问题变得尤为重要。当玩家在游戏中投入时间和金钱时,他们需要确保这些资产不会被黑客攻击或其他形式的风险所损失。区块链游戏面临的主要安全风险包括智能合约漏洞、中心化风险、社交工程攻击等。 ### 智能合约漏洞 智能合约是区块链游戏中的核心组件,被用来管理游戏逻辑、交易以及资产的转移。然而,智能合约代码可能存在漏洞,若被攻击者利用,可能造成资产的丧失。例如,某些合约在设计时并未充分考虑到异常输入,可能导致恶意用户进行空投攻击。 为防范这种风险,开发者应在部署智能合约之前进行全面的代码审计,以确保其安全性。此外,使用开源的代码库降低了自身代码中潜在漏洞的风险。 ### 中心化风险 尽管区块链游戏追求去中心化,但在实际运作中,某些元素仍然可能存在中心化。例如,游戏发行方可能会对资产进行控制或影响游戏运行,从而产生风险。一些项目可能在设计上缺乏透明度,导致玩家难以评估风险。 为缓解中心化风险,开发者应该明确发布相应的透明度报告,让玩家了解游戏的经济模型与治理结构。同时,建立强大的社区治理机制,让玩家在游戏的发展中拥有发言权。 ### 社交工程攻击 社交工程攻击是一种常见的网络攻击形式,攻击者常常通过欺骗手段获取用户的密码或资产。区块链游戏玩家在这些攻击面前并不安全,因为许多玩家对于安全的认知不足,容易受到欺诈。 为了增强玩家的安全意识,游戏开发者可以提供安全教育,并提醒玩家在进行交易时保持警惕。更好的身份验证和多重签名机制也可以有效预防此类攻击。 ## 如何提升区块链游戏的安全性 ### 制定全面的安全策略 开发者在创建区块链游戏时,首先需要制定全面的安全策略。这包括智能合约的代码审计、漏洞修复、用户数据的加密存储等。此外,定期进行安全性测试,以识别并处理系统中的潜在漏洞,也是非常重要的。 ### 采用最佳开发实践 采用最佳开发实践能够有效减少安全漏洞的产生。例如,使用经过验证的开发工具与框架,遵循编码标准以及设计模式,能够帮助开发者提升代码质量。此外,逐步迭代而非一次性推出大型更新,也可以降低风险。 ### 加强玩家教育与社区建设 对于玩家而言,加强安全意识是保障自身资产安全的重要措施。开发者可以通过教程、博客与社区讨论等多种形式向玩家传递安全知识。此外,建立积极的社区氛围能够促进信息的流通,使玩家在遭遇问题时能够及时获得帮助。 ## 相关问题探讨 ### 如何评估区块链游戏的安全性?

在选择参与某款区块链游戏时,安全性评估是不可或缺的一步。玩家需要关注多个方面来判断一款区块链游戏的安全性。首先,查看该游戏的开发团队背景与声誉,了解他们在区块链行业的经验与历史。在很多情况下,一个知名的团队意味着更高的安全性。

其次,玩家需关注该游戏所使用的区块链平台的安全性。公认的、成熟的区块链平台通常会拥有严格的安全机制,更能保障游戏资产的安全。另外,智能合约的审计报告也是重要的评估依据,透明的审计报告意味着开发者对游戏的安全性较为重视。

再者,了解游戏的经济模型与治理结构。过于复杂或缺乏透明度的经济模型往往意味着潜在的风险。此外,玩家应定期关注游戏的更新与维护活动,活跃的开发团队通常会及时修复漏洞,保证游戏安全性。

### 区块链游戏的安全性规定存在哪些不足?

尽管区块链游戏近年来受到广泛关注,但相关的安全性规定仍存在许多不足之处。当前,对区块链游戏的监管相对薄弱,很多国家尚未制定专门的法律法规来规范这一新兴领域。这导致开发者在安全性方面的责任模糊,可能在出现问题时推卸责任。

此外,现行的法律法规难以跟上区块链技术和市场发展的速度,导致许多潜在的安全风险无法得到及时解决。例如,关于身份验证、资产归属等关键问题,缺乏适用原则与标准。

为改善这种状况,必须通过行业自律、政府监管和用户教育三者结合,逐步完善相关规范。比如,行业组织可以制定相应的最佳实践标准,并鼓励开发者自我审查与透明化。政府则可以逐步介入,以法律手段加强监管。

### 如何防范区块链游戏中的诈骗与欺诈?

随着区块链游戏的不断发展,诈骗与欺诈行为也愈演愈烈,严重危害了玩家的利益。要防范此类行为,玩家首先需要提高警惕,不随便点击不明链接或下载不明应用。尤其在进行资产交易时,应确保所有交易均在安全的平台上进行。

其次,游戏开发者应设置二次验证机制,例如通过电子邮件或短信发送验证链接,以确保交易的合法性。此外,利用多重签名技术,可以降低资产被盗的风险。

对于社区来说,建立举报机制至关重要,玩家应及时向门槛举报可疑用户,以防其继续进行诈骗行为。开发者同样可以通过实时监控交易,发现异常活动并采取措施。

### 未来区块链游戏的安全发展趋势如何?

区块链游戏的安全性在未来将朝着更加智能化和全面化的方向发展。随着技术的不断进步,智能合约的安全检测与审计工具将变得更为智能和高效,能够自动检测代码中的潜在漏洞并提供改进建议。

同时,玩家对安全性的重视程度将持续升高,行业内对透明度的要求也会越来越大。未来的区块链游戏开发者需要加强与玩家的沟通,及时提供安全更新与信息共享,以建立稳定的信任关系。

此外,可能会有更多的政府与机构意识到区块链游戏的潜力与风险,进而加强监管。同时,行业协会的建立将有望推动自律机制的完善及产学研的合作,从而有效促进整个行业的健康发展。

## 结语 区块链游戏的安全性虽然面临诸多挑战,但通过充分的评估和针对性的措施,可以有效降低风险。开发者、玩家与监管机构应共同努力,携手打造更加安全、透明和可持续的区块链游戏生态。